What you will do
  • Provides nursing care from the initial contact until patient care is relinquished to the accepting medical facility; maintains thorough patient care documentation.
  • Practices nursing within his/her scope of practice as defined by the states regulating each base.
  • Knowledgeable in use and routine maintenance of all equipment and supplies used by Pedi-Flite. Responsible for reporting medical equipment failures and taking initial steps to insure repair of equipment as directed. Maintains adequate supplies onboard aircraft and ambulance to deliver patient care. Keeps aircraft clean and orderly to insure rapid response to all transport requests.
  • Maintains positive interpersonal relationships with colleagues, EMS representatives, hospitals and the public.
  • Functions as a medical flight member preforming required briefs, documentation etc.
  • Performs advanced skills and procedures as approved by Pedi-Flite Medical Director(s) which includes ETT tube placement, Ventilators, Nitric administration, etc.
  • Serves as a role model, educator and clinical resource.
  • Participates regularly in Pedi-Flite activities, meetings, education, projects and committees.
  • Performs other duties as assigned or requested
